Insulated siding installation services involve attaching specialized siding materials to the exterior of a building to improve its thermal performance. This process typically includes removing existing siding, preparing the surface, and installing insulated panels or siding that contain foam or other insulating materials. The goal is to enhance energy efficiency by reducing heat transfer through walls, which can lead to lower heating and cooling costs. Professional installers ensure that the insulation is properly integrated with the siding to maximize its thermal benefits and maintain the building’s exterior appearance.
One of the primary issues insulated siding helps address is energy loss through poorly insulated walls. Buildings with outdated or damaged siding often experience drafts, uneven indoor temperatures, and increased utility bills. Insulated siding provides a barrier that helps maintain consistent indoor comfort by minimizing heat exchange with the outside environment. Additionally, it can help protect the underlying wall structure from moisture infiltration and weather-related damage, which can contribute to long-term maintenance savings and structural integrity.

Material Costs - Insulated siding materials typically range from $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on quality and brand. For a standard 2,000-square-foot home, material costs can vary from $4,000 to $16,000.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$1.50 and $4 per square foot. This can result in total labor charges ranging from $3,000 to $8,000 for an average-sized residence.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of existing siding, which can add $1,000 to $3,000. Other factors like insulation upgrades or trim work can also influence the overall expense.
Project Total - The complete cost for insulated siding installation typically falls between $7,000 and $25,000. Actual prices depend on home size, siding choices, and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
